About:China Customs Declaration

gifts for friends and family

We are living and working legally in China. We are going on holiday to South Africa, our home country. We want to take battery packs you use to recharge cell phones for 4 friends as well as some clothing items. Is it allowed?

Hannes, clothing items are allowed to enter China. However, you'd better consult with your airline you choose to take you back to China what the requirements they have on the battery packs. According to what I know, passengers are allowed to bring batteries below 100wh in their carry-on luggage. If its storage is between 100 to 160wh, they need to ask permission from the airline. And they can not take more than 2 pieces. If it is larger than 160wh, they are not allowed to bring them in their carry-on luggage and checked luggage.
